Purpose: The purpose of this exercise is to learn how to enter repair codes. Repair codes represent generic definitions of repair activity used to perform or build up a repair. Sets of one or more repair codes are then built up as a way to identify the steps required to repair a modification or discrepancy. Repair codes are also used in combination with monolithic repair structures and routings to to define the set of operations and components are needed to perform a specific repair code on a particular part.
